14. Great Dane

The Great Dane is not a miniature horse but a massive dog. Usually gentle and patient with children, they can stand up to 32 inches at the shoulder. Great Danes are vigilant and must adapt to home life, as their calm nature can change quickly. According to the American Kennel Club, they can reach greater heights than most people when on their hind legs. With a single paw swipe, a Great Dane can knock down a person of any size.
